[s1e8] Three's A Crowd Instant
: Carrie's anxiety peaks when she discovers Mr. Big was previously married. After meeting his "perfect" ex-wife, Barbara, Carrie becomes obsessed with whether she can compete with his past and whether Big is capable of another serious commitment.
